ABB AI835A S800 Thermocouple/mV Input Module: 8-Channel Precision

Detailed Technical Specifications

  • Brand: ABB
  • Model: AI835A (Article 3BSE051306R1)
  • Type: Thermocouple/mV Input Module for S800
  • Number of Channels: 8 differential inputs
  • Measurement Ranges: -30 to +75 mV linear; All major thermocouple types
  • Resolution: 15 bits
  • Input Impedance: > 1 MΩ
  • Measurement Error: Maximum 0.1% of range
  • Temperature Drift: Typically 5 ppm/°C, Maximum 7 ppm/°C
  • Update Cycle Time (50 Hz): 280 + 80 × (active channels) ms
  • Update Cycle Time (60 Hz): 250 + 70 × (active channels) ms
  • Normal Mode Rejection Ratio (NMRR): >60 dB at 50/60 Hz
  • Common Mode Rejection Ratio (CMRR): 120 dB at 50/60 Hz
  • Maximum Field Cable Length: 600 meters
  • Power Dissipation: 1.6 Watts
  • Rated Insulation Voltage: 50 V
  • Dielectric Test Voltage: 500 V AC

Cold Junction Compensation Features

  • Channel 8 can function as a dedicated cold junction compensation channel
  • Compensation uses a 4-wire Pt100 RTD for high accuracy
  • Measure junction temperature locally at MTU terminals or remotely
  • Users can set a fixed junction temperature as a parameter value
  • The AI835A allows junction temperature setting from the application
  • Channel 8 operates as a normal input when not used for compensation
  • Diagnostics monitor CJ-channel for temperatures outside -40°C to +100°C

Environmental Ratings and Compliance

  • Operating Temperature: 0 to +55 °C (approved range +5 to +55 °C)
  • Storage Temperature: -40 to +70 °C
  • Relative Humidity: 5 to 95%, non-condensing
  • Pollution Degree: 2
  • Protection Class: IP20
  • Corrosion Protection: ISA-S71.04 G3
  • Safety Standards: EN/UL 61010-1, EN/UL 61010-2-201
  • Hazardous Location Approvals: Class I Div 2, ATEX Zone 2
  • Marine Certifications: ABS, BV, DNV, LR
  • EMC Standards: EN 61000-6-2, EN 61000-6-4
  • RoHS Compliance: Yes (Directive 2011/65/EU)

Frequently Asked Questions (FAQ)

  • Q: What is the difference between AI835 and AI835A modules?
    A: The ABB AI835A supports additional thermocouple types D, L, and U, while the AI835 supports types B, C, E, J, K, N, R, S, T.
  • Q: How many temperature input channels does this module have?
    A: Both AI835/AI835A provide 8 differential input channels for thermocouple or mV signals.
  • Q: What is cold junction compensation and how does it work?
    A: Channel 8 can use a 4-wire Pt100 RTD to measure ambient temperature for accurate thermocouple cold junction compensation.
  • Q: What thermocouple types does the AI835A support?
    A: The AI835A supports types B, C, D, E, J, K, L, N, R, S, T, and U thermocouples.
  • Q: Does the module detect sensor connection problems?
    A: Yes, the module monitors all inputs for wire-break open-circuit conditions and provides diagnostics.
  • Q: What is the measurement resolution of these modules?
    A: Both modules provide 15-bit resolution for high-precision temperature measurements.
  • Q: Can I use channel 8 as a regular input channel?
    A: Yes, channel 8 functions as a normal thermocouple/mV input when not configured for cold junction compensation.
  • Q: What MTU units are compatible with these modules?
    A: They work with ABB MTUs including TU810, TU812, TU814, TU818, TU830, and TU833 with keying code BA.
